The Clearpool Oracle voting results are in, with Oracles adjusting interest rates based on current market pricing.​ The optimal interest rate (Ym) for AA-rated borrowers has been reduced from 12.​84% to 12.​65%.​

Key points:

  • Voting results published on Clearpool's Medium blog
  • Multiple Oracles participated in the voting process
  • Interest rate adjustment affects various borrowers

This update follows the previous adjustment on October 15, 2024, maintaining Clearpool's dynamic approach to interest rates in the DeFi space.​

Clearpool Reaches $850M Milestone in Total Loans Originated

**Clearpool has achieved $850 million in total loans originated** across its decentralized lending platform. The milestone represents significant growth from the $202M reported in July, demonstrating strong institutional adoption of on-chain private credit solutions. **Key developments:** - Platform serves trading firms and expanding into PayFi sector - Previous growth driven by larger loans to institutional borrowers - U.S. regulatory clarity boosting institutional demand Clearpool operates as a **decentralized marketplace for unsecured digital asset liquidity**, allowing institutional borrowers to access uncollateralized loans directly from lenders. Clearpool Leads USDX Stablecoin Growth with T-Pool Launch

Clearpool Leads USDX Stablecoin Growth with T-Pool Launch

Clearpool has launched T-Pool for USDX, a T-Bill backed stablecoin from Hex Trust. Key highlights: - USDX maintains 1:1 USD peg, backed by 1-3 month Treasury Bills - T-Pool offers 3.6% APY in USDX yield plus 7.07% in WFLR rewards - $24.5M TVL achieved, representing 90% of minted USDX - Trading available on Curve Finance and BitMart - No lock-up periods, instant deposits/withdrawals The broader stablecoin market shows significant growth: - Market cap up 32% to $250B in past 6 months - JPMorgan projects $500B market by 2028 - Standard Chartered forecasts $2T by 2028 Recent GENIUS Act passage provides regulatory framework for continued growth.
